It was probably me, as well as some other people. I have noticed a dramatic increase in the number of floaters. I cannot pinpoint the date when this happened. However, it was probably about a month ago.
I remember seeing floaters as a child. I did have quite a few of them, but they were not very troublesome. I remember "chasing" them around with my eyes.
However, after the potential exposure I saw a significant increase in the number of floaters. I believe it was gradual, because I remember observing that my vision was slightly "weird", as I understand now, due to the presence of floaters.
Currently floaters present a major problem. They have increased dramatically, and I see them most of the time. They are highly annoying, especially when I go out on a bright day, sit in a bright room with white walls and halogen lamps, or use my computer.
Most doctors believe they are unrelated. This is also true of the Helpline people. There are numerous reasons why floaters can appear. One is CMV-related retinitis, which happens in late-stage disease, when CD4 < 50. This would be accompanied by many other manifestations, so it is unlikely.
